## Step 4: Dual-write phase

Before cutting Lanternbase over to the new schema, enable dual writes on the Fernwick API. Old and new tables stay in sync while backfill runs. Do not drop columns yet — the legacy reader in Quillport still depends on them. Verify row counts match on both sides before proceeding to step 5. The dual-write worker reads these settings at startup, so confirm them against what's below.

service settings:
[silwyn]
host = silwyn.crelvogrid.internal
user = silwyn_svc
database = silwyn_prod

**Handover: PixVault image-cache leak**

Hi — passing this to you before the release cut. The PixVault thumbnail cache leaks memory under heavy browse traffic; workers climb to the limit over about six hours, then get recycled. Temporary mitigation: we shortened eviction intervals and lowered the max entry count, which keeps things stable enough to ship. Root cause is probably the retained decode buffers — Priya has a branch in progress. The mitigation settings currently in prod are below.

config for badup-kagap:
OLIOX_PIN=5344
OLIOX_METRICS_HOST=metrics.oliox.zemvarcorp.corp
OLIOX_LOG_LEVEL=error
OLIOX_TENANT=pelox

Meeting Notes — Records Excerpt

Discussed outgoing sample shipments to Brighthollow Analytics, our partner lab. Six vials per batch, foam-packed, manifests duplicated for our files. Rena confirmed weekly cadence starting Thursday. Records team to retain the pink copy of each manifest before dispatch. Temperature loggers go in every third shipment. The agreed courier hand-over instruction is recorded directly below.

handover note for bajog-tawig: the lamion quenael courier leaves the wendor ledger at gate 1289 under passcode 760784

**Vendor note: Inkmill markdown pipeline**

Rendering for Parchway docs is outsourced to Inkmill under an annual contract, renewing each March. They handle sanitization and PDF export; we own the upload queue. SLA: 4-hour response on rendering failures. Escalate only after two failed retries. Their support desk is reachable at the address below.

billing contact of hahaf-baguf = zorael.tammir.jorius@sivrelhq.internal